The Mass Cane Plant was initially released on May 15, 2016, in Treetop Gardens. …Aug 10, 2023 · The plants like its warm, but not too hot or cold. Keep it between 60°F and 75°F. Provide some humidity for the plant by misting the leaves occasionally or using a humidifier. Aim for 40% to 50% humidity. Fertilize the plant once a month during the growing season (spring and summer) with a balanced liquid fertilizer diluted to half strength. Jun 16, 2023 · Mass cane, also known as corn plant or Dracaena fragrans, is a popular indoor plant that is toxic to cats when ingested. The plant contains compounds called saponins, which can cause digestive upset and even organ damage in cats. The signs of mass cane toxicity in cats can vary depending on the amount ingested and the individual cat's sensitivity. Tall Green Schefflera Capella; Bright, Indirect Sunlight Plant in 10in. Grower Pot.Mass Cane plants typically bloom in their natural environment; however, this is a rare occurrence when kept indoors. If your Mass Cane plant does bloom, it produces fragrant, small, white flowers in clusters. In Europe, back in the 1700s the Dracaena Massangeana made its mark as an indoor plant, along with the Kentia palm, cast-iron plants (Aspidistra elatior), and what we know as the “Boston fern”. In general, a balanced fertilizer with ...Dracaena Massangeana is a decently drought-tolerant plant and does not require much water to survive. Allow the top inch (0.5 centimetres) or so of the soil to dry out between waterings, and then thoroughly water the plant. Overwatering can lead to root rot, so it’s essential to avoid keeping the soil constantly saturated. Dracaena fragrans, or corn plant.
